Transaction 6b956bc14110c9a8083be6602afee4a45f8a3a86b7262148a373bfa3ef158d23
1 Input
1 Output
-
6b956bc14110c9a8083be6602afee4a45f8a3a86b7262148a373bfa3ef158d23:0
- value
- 299088
- script pubkey
- OP_0 OP_PUSHBYTES_20 9358d423099f29e9626eb263eff430dd493ff27e
- address
- bc1qjdvdggcfnu57jcnwkf37lapsm4ynlun7gzn8eg